On , OSHA opened a referral safety inspection of S AND T MAGIC CO, INC in NEW YORK STATE FAIRGROUNDS, SYRACUSE, NY 13209 (NAICS 713990). OSHA activity number 307685461.

1 citation on file for this inspection.

5(a)(1)

Serious Gravity 03 1 instance 1 exposed
Issued
Aug 31, 2004
Abate by
Sep 3, 2004
Penalty
Initial $375 · Current $250 Reduced
Section 5(a)(1) of the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970:  The
employer did not
fur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from
recognized hazards that
were causing or likely to cause death or serious physical harm to
employees in that employees
were exposed to Fall Hazards:
a)New York State Fairgrounds Midway, on or about 08/24/2004: One employee
was disconnecting the Gondola pins of a Century Wheel Carnival Ride at a
height of 25 feet above the lower surface without fall protection.
Among other methods one feasible and acceptable method to correct the fall
hazard
is to:
Install and use a fall protection system to maintain 100fall protection.
